Every time 'Element' (The Matrix chat app) gets a mention, it resorts into questioning the name or a disambiguation. The technology, product and pricing with the deals they are making with multiple governments and businesses is an excellent source of revenue and is very competitive at striking those deals. However the genericness of the name will be a problem with non-technical users and will always be an issue with Element which is a problem the parent has highlighted. The SEO on the name is terrible and doesn't come up on Google, Bing or DDG. The fustrating part? They were so close on deciding to rebrand everything and have ruined it on the name (for now). It's not too late though. I guess they will have rename Element again in order to expand into becoming a true WhatsApp alternative mindshare-wise. Right now the name is quite frankly unappealing, but everything else is the gold standard. |
